Subject: Flagwheel cut-over complete

Plugin authors: the Flagwheel rollout framework is now live on all Dorvane Systems tenants. Legacy toggles are frozen; new flags must register through the v2 manifest. Evaluation latency dropped ~40%. Stale flag warnings start next Monday. Migration tooling handles most cases automatically. Update your plugin manifests before Friday. The current production configuration values are listed below.

service settings:
PRAIX_LOG_LEVEL=error
PRAIX_METRICS_HOST=metrics.praix.qorvelcorp.corp
PRAIX_POOL_SIZE=16

Subject: RestockPilot cut-over complete

Team,

The vending-machine restock planner (RestockPilot) moved to the new Skarvane cluster last night. Route generation, bin-level forecasts, and the driver manifest export all verified against Tuesday's snapshot. Old hosts stay read-only for two weeks, then decommission. For future maintainers: the service now starts with the following configuration values.

settings of fafog-haduf:
ZORIX_PIN=4648
ZORIX_METRICS_HOST=metrics.zorix.paliqsys.corp
ZORIX_LOG_LEVEL=info
ZORIX_TENANT=druix

Welcome to the Cadencewave release team. The audio waveform preview in Soundloom renders peaks client-side, so release builds must bundle the precomputed peak cache before signing. Verify the cache checksum against the build manifest, then confirm the preview loads for both mono and stereo fixtures on the staging player. If the preview vault is locked during cutover, unlock it with the recovery passphrase below.

strongbox words: fraath-isteth

## Releases

Flagweave releases are cut every Thursday ahead of the eng sync. Each release bundles the rollout controller, the targeting DSL compiler, and the audit sidecar into a single versioned archive. Before tagging, run the full gate-simulation suite and confirm the staged-percentage tests pass on the Bellmoor cluster. Tags must be signed so downstream consumers can verify provenance automatically. The deploy key currently authorized for publishing Flagweave releases is listed below for reference.

release key, hagug-yaguf: bky13_NnhXrmFGhCRtW